1. 在main.js中注册组件
Vue.component('footerm', {
props: ['title'],
template: '<footer>{{title}}</footer>'
})
2. 在页面中使用
home.vue
<template>
<div>
<footerm :title="'这是底部文字'"></footerm>
</div>
</template>
运行后如果报错:You are using the runtime-only build of Vue where the template compiler is not available. Either pre-compile the templates into render functions, or use the compiler-included build.
解决方法:
打开vue.config.js中添加以下代码
参考:https://blog.csdn.net/COCOLI_BK/article/details/108866842
module.exports = {
runtimeCompiler: true
}
本文介绍了如何在Vue项目中遇到'runtime-only build'错误时,通过修改vue.config.js添加`runtimeCompiler: true`来解决。主要步骤涉及在main.js中注册带有prop的组件并正确使用在home.vue页面,以及设置Vue编译器配置以确保模板编译。
796

被折叠的 条评论
为什么被折叠?



